Hi we have a very old seldom used Mira 7.5kw electric shower, (we use our other mains shower instead) this morning the shower started leaking out the box, turned the water and electric supply off and took cover off (see pictures) the bracket has cracked and water leaking from the pipe joint (arrowed) with the shower being over 25yrs old we have arranged to get it replaced but with the bank hols etc can't get done until Tuesday. We tried turning water back on briefly (to flush toilet, run washing up etc) the shower then started leaking heavily. We can't place the isolator valve, the shower seems to be fed by a pipe in the airing cupboard but there doesn't seem to be a valve on it. So we have had to keep our water off completely- has anyone any ideas about a temporary solution so we can turn the water back on please?
Is the isolator valve accessible if we remove the shower behind it?

You would need to remove the shower from the wall and cap the supply pipe if there is no isolation valve on the supply to it. I think it's unlikely that there is an isolation valve directly behind the shower.
 
Yep. Either emergency plumber time or remove it. Make power safe and cap the cold feed.
